对象存储和文件存储的优缺点是什么,深入剖析,对象存储与文件存储的优缺点对比
- 综合资讯
- 2024-11-27 08:17:47
- 2

对象存储和文件存储在数据存储方面各有特点。对象存储优点在于数据管理灵活、扩展性强,适合非结构化数据存储;缺点是访问速度相对较慢,接口复杂。文件存储则访问速度快,适合结构...
对象存储和文件存储在数据存储方面各有特点。对象存储优点在于数据管理灵活、扩展性强,适合非结构化数据存储;缺点是访问速度相对较慢,接口复杂。文件存储则访问速度快,适合结构化数据存储,但扩展性较差,管理相对复杂。两者在应用场景和性能上存在明显差异。
随着互联网技术的飞速发展,数据存储技术也日益成熟,对象存储和文件存储作为数据存储的两种主要方式,各有其独特的优势与劣势,本文将从多个角度对比分析对象存储和文件存储的优缺点,以帮助读者更好地了解这两种存储方式。
对象存储与文件存储的定义
1、对象存储
对象存储是一种基于对象的存储技术,将数据以对象的形式存储,每个对象由唯一标识符、数据本身以及元数据组成,对象存储通常用于大规模、非结构化数据的存储,如图片、视频、文档等。
2、文件存储
文件存储是一种基于文件系统的存储技术,将数据以文件的形式存储,每个文件包含数据本身以及文件元数据,文件存储适用于结构化数据的存储,如文档、数据库等。
对象存储与文件存储的优缺点
1、对象存储的优点
(1)存储容量大:对象存储能够存储海量数据,满足大规模数据存储需求。
(2)数据访问速度快:对象存储通常采用分布式存储架构,数据访问速度快,可满足实时访问需求。
(3)数据安全性高:对象存储支持数据加密、权限控制等安全机制,保障数据安全。
(4)扩展性强:对象存储可根据需求灵活扩展存储容量,适应业务发展。
(5)跨地域部署:对象存储支持跨地域部署,提高数据可用性。
2、对象存储的缺点
(1)成本较高:对象存储在存储、访问和管理方面成本较高。
(2)数据管理复杂:对象存储需要管理大量对象,数据管理相对复杂。
(3)不支持复杂查询:对象存储主要针对非结构化数据,不支持复杂查询。
3、文件存储的优点
(1)成本较低:文件存储在存储、访问和管理方面成本较低。
(2)数据管理简单:文件存储基于文件系统,数据管理相对简单。
(3)支持复杂查询:文件存储支持复杂查询,适用于结构化数据。
(4)易于备份与恢复:文件存储易于备份与恢复,保障数据安全。
4、文件存储的缺点
(1)存储容量有限:文件存储容量受限于文件系统,难以满足大规模数据存储需求。
(2)数据访问速度慢:文件存储在数据访问速度方面相对较慢,难以满足实时访问需求。
(3)数据安全性相对较低:文件存储数据安全性相对较低,易受病毒、恶意攻击等威胁。
应用场景分析
1、对象存储的应用场景
(1)大规模非结构化数据存储:如图片、视频、文档等。
(2)大数据分析:如搜索引擎、推荐系统等。
(3)云存储:如云盘、云服务等。
2、文件存储的应用场景
(1)结构化数据存储:如文档、数据库等。
(2)传统企业IT系统:如OA、ERP等。
(3)个人电脑存储:如照片、音乐等。
对象存储和文件存储作为数据存储的两种主要方式,各有其独特的优势与劣势,在实际应用中,应根据业务需求、数据特点等因素选择合适的存储方式,随着技术的不断发展,未来对象存储和文件存储可能会实现更好的融合,为数据存储领域带来更多创新。
本文链接:https://www.zhitaoyun.cn/1116889.html
发表评论